Description:
Description:
The NVE ADH0xx Series GMR Switch uses NVEs high sensitivity, high temperature
GMR material to provide a very low magnetic field operate point. It offers the same
precision operate points over all temperature and input voltage conditions as our other
GMR Switch products. It is available in standard form as the NVE ADH025-00 with a
magnetic trigger field of 10 Gauss, a current sinking output, and a cross axis
configuration. Custom versions with trigger fields ranging from 6 to 40 Gauss, and
different output options and sensitivity directions could be manufactured for specific
customer requirements; please contact NVE for details.
